Job description

Purpose

The HR Specialist - Talent Development & Learning will be the primary Learning Management System (LMS) administrator and system expert for Lidl US. Operating under the Employee Lifecycle team and Talent Development & Learning leadership, this role ensures seamless training delivery, maintains high data integrity within SuccessFactors, and provides system support to HQ and regional teams. By managing the LMS, this position helps drive business and operational excellence through maintaining a robust catalog of training offerings and monitoring training compliance. This role is a true LMS subject matter expert for all training, learning, onboarding & development aspects of the business.

Responsibilities
Learning Management System (LMS) Administrator:
  • Serves as the primary system administrator for SuccessFactors Learning System, ensuring platform integrity, user access, and back-end configurations.
  • Configures, tests, and maintains LMS platform customizations and key user role permissions based on organizational requirements.
  • Assigns and manages system key user role assignments to ensure appropriate data and back-end administration access.
  • Manages all course content within the system such as uploading e-learning packages, external content management, and ensures they function correctly on different devices.
  • Supports scheduling of training courses and set up of assignment profiles, curriculums based on mandatory training requirements.
  • Audits system assignment profiles, content, resources, and instructors regularly to ensure offerings and all available resources stay up-to-date.
  • Conducts rigorous quality assurance (QA) testing on all course items, resources, and assignment profiles prior to publishing to front-end users.
  • Partners with Talent Development leadership and content owners to build courses, curricula, and assignment profiles for onboarding, mandatory training, and professional development.
  • Generates, compiles, and analyzes learning data reports to monitor training compliance and support business analytics.
  • Provides front-line troubleshooting and technical resolution support to HQ and regional team members.
  • Coordinates general training logistics, calendar invites, and administrative preparation for live or virtual learning programs.
  • Performs other HR, Learning & Development, and administrative duties or ad-hoc projects as assigned to support broader team and organizational goals.
  • Facilitates hands-on training and upskilling for internal Learning Specialists on core SuccessFactors LMS functions to establish cross-coverage, build team capacity, and ensure continuous administrative support.
